Abstract:Illegal mining has a great influence on stability of mines. In the paper,two-dimensional numerical simulation on Jinshandian underground iron mine is carried out by using finite element method and discrete element method. The regulations of surface deformation and surrounding rock movement with/without illegal mining are obtained,respectively. The obtained results indicate that an elliptic disturbed zone is formed around underground gob and the major axis of ellipse is parallel with the tendency of the orebody. Gobs formed by illegal mining and underground mining will not connect. In addition,illegal mining has little influence on the size of underground disturbed zone. Because of stress redistribution caused by illegal mining,the size of surface subsidence increases near surface gob;and horizontal displacement of surface increases greatly,but the range of surface subsidence is almost found without change.
